Immersive Experiences: Beyond the Reels
Online casinos are no longer just about clicking buttons. They’re evolving into immersive experiences. Think of it like this: instead of just playing a game, you’re entering a virtual world.
Key Trends in Immersive Gaming:
- Live Dealer Games: These games bring the casino atmosphere directly to your screen. You’ll interact with real dealers via live video streams, playing games like blackjack, roulette, and baccarat. It’s the closest you can get to a real casino experience without leaving your house.
-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R): While still in its early stages, VR and AR are poised to revolutionise online gambling. Imagine putting on a VR headset and walking around a virtual casino, interacting with other players and playing games in a fully immersive environment.
- Gamification: Online casinos are incorporating elements of game design to make the experience more engaging. This includes things like loyalty programs, challenges, and leaderboards to keep you entertained and coming back for more.
The Security Scene: Keeping Your Data Safe
With more and more people playing online, security is paramount. Online casinos are investing heavily in protecting your personal and financial information.
What to Look for in a Secure Online Casino:
- Licensing and Regulation: Always choose casinos that are licensed and regulated by reputable auth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or the UK Gambling Commission. These bodies ensure the casino operates fairly and securely.
- Encryption Technology: Look for casinos that use SSL (Secure Socket Layer) encryption to protect your data. This technology scrambles your information, making it difficult for hackers to access it.
- Responsible Gambling Tools: Reputable casinos offer tools to help you gamble responsibly, such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organisations.
Payment Methods: Quick, Easy, and Secure Transactions
Making deposits and withdrawals should be a smooth and hassle-free process. Online casinos are offering a wider range of payment options to cater to different preferences.
Popular Payment Methods:
- E-wallets: P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ller are popular choices for their speed and security.
- Credit and Debit Cards: Visa and Mastercard are widely accepted.
- Bank Transfers: A reliable option, although it can take a few days for the transaction to process.
- Cryptocurrencies: Some casinos are starting to accept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ies, offering anonymity and faster transactions.
